U.S. Navy Seaman 1st Class Clyde C. McMeans, 26, was one of the 103 USS California crewmen killed during attacks on Pearl Harbor in 1941.
In less than a year, another Coastal Bend Sailor, Clyde McMeans, killed at Pearl Harbor, is finally identified 84 years later. Last year, a local from the same ship was also laid to rest.
